House Bill 1280
2023-2024 Regular Session
An Act amending the act of April 9, 1929 (P.L.177, No.175), known as The Administrative Code of 1929, in administrative organization, further providing for Pennsylvania State Police.

Bill Status & History
Last Action: Re-referred to Appropriations, Dec. 12, 2023 Senate
H
S
1396 Referred to Judiciary, May 31, 2023
Reported as committed, June 14, 2023
First consideration, June 14, 2023
Re-committed to Rules, June 14, 2023
Re-reported as committed, June 21, 2023
Second consideration, June 22, 2023
Re-committed to Appropriations, June 22, 2023
Re-reported as committed, June 26, 2023
Third consideration and final passage, June 26, 2023 (203-0)
(Remarks see House Journal Page 850-851), June 26, 2023
In the Senate
Referred to Law & Justice, June 30, 2023
Reported as committed, Dec. 11, 2023
First consideration, Dec. 11, 2023
Second consideration, Dec. 12, 2023
Re-referred to Appropriations, Dec. 12, 2023
